How they compare
Ile de France currently reports 148.9 Thousand persons against 128.7 Thousand persons in Bosnia and Herzegovina, a difference of 20.2 Thousand persons.
That makes Ile de France's figure about 1.2 times Bosnia and Herzegovina's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2021 it was Bosnia and Herzegovina ahead.
Bosnia and Herzegovina ranks 12th and Ile de France ranks 9th of 48 countries.
